XL 2019 Excel ajouter en A1 1 mois à A1 de la feuille précédente sans vba

DédéW83

XLDnaute Junior
Bonjour à tous,
j'ai des feuilles qui se nomment 2207 pour juillet 2022, etc, je voudrais ajouter en A1 1 mois à A1 de la feuille précédente sans vba, mais je sèche...
En'2207'A1 j'ai 01/07/2022 en format m. En B1 j'ai =A1 en format aaaa
Je veux donc incrémenter A1 sur toutes les feuilles avec A1+1des feuilles précédentes.
qui a la solution?
 

Pièces jointes

  • exemple 1.xlsx
    16.5 KB · Affichages: 12
Solution
J'ai regardé, et effectivement, il y a un problème quand c'est supérieur à "09".

Perso j'utiliserai ça, qui se base réellement sur le contenu de la cellule A1 de la "feuille précédente", comme demandé au départ :
Code:
=MOIS.DECALER(INDIRECT(STXT(CELLULE("nomfichier";A1);NBCAR(CELLULE("nomfichier";A1))-3;2) & DROITE("0" & (DROITE(CELLULE("nomfichier";A1);2)-1);2) & "!A1");1)

Ou ça, qui ne répond pas à la question initiale puisque ça se base sur le nom de l'onglet, mais qui semble tout de même faire ce que tu veux :
Code:
=DATE(2000+STXT(CELLULE("nomfichier";A1);NBCAR(CELLULE("nomfichier";A1))-3;2);DROITE(CELLULE("nomfichier";A1);2);1)
Bonjour TooFatBoy, je suis de retour.
J'ai fait un petit changement et simplifié. Si tu veux...

Discussions similaires

Membres actuellement en ligne

Aucun membre en ligne actuellement.

Statistiques des forums

Discussions
312 493
Messages
2 088 956
Membres
103 990
dernier inscrit
lamiadebz